get carried away — phrase to become so excited or involved in something that you lose control of your feelings or behaviour Let’s not get carried away. The deal could still fall through. Thesaurus: become excitedsynonym Main entry: carry * * * be/get carried aˈway… … Useful english dictionary
get carried away — to become so excited or involved in something that you lose control of your feelings or behaviour Let s not get carried away. The deal could still fall through … English dictionary
